Ukrainian Hryvnia
The Ukrainian Hryvnia (UAH) is the official currency of Ukraine, used for all monetary transactions within the country.
History/Origin
The Hryvnia was first introduced in Ukraine in 1918 during the brief independence period, replaced by the Soviet ruble. It was reintroduced in 1996 after Ukraine gained independence from the Soviet Union, replacing the karbovanets as the national currency.
Current Use
Today, the Hryvnia is the sole legal tender in Ukraine, widely used in everyday transactions, banking, and financial markets. It is managed by the National Bank of Ukraine and features modern banknotes and coins.
Singapore Dollar
The Singapore Dollar (SGD) is the official currency of Singapore, used for all monetary transactions within the country.
History/Origin
The Singapore Dollar was introduced in 1967, replacing the Malayan dollar, and has since evolved into a stable currency managed by the Monetary Authority of Singapore.
Current Use
Today, the SGD is widely used in Singapore for everyday transactions, banking, and international trade, and is considered a major Asian currency.
